Description

4-(1-Bromoethyl)Benzonitrile is a versatile benzonitrile derivative and a valuable halogenated aromatic building block. This compound is crucial for organic synthesis, particularly in the construction of complex molecules for advanced material and pharmaceutical research. It serves as a key intermediate for researchers and manufacturers in the pharmaceutical, agrochemical, and specialty chemical industries seeking to introduce functionalized aromatic moieties.

Application

  • Pharmaceutical Intermediate: A critical synthon for the development of active pharmaceutical ingredients (APIs), especially those containing substituted benzonitrile or phenethylamine cores.
  • Agrochemical Synthesis: Used in the research and production of advanced herbicides, fungicides, and pesticides where its bromoethyl group enables further functionalization.
  • Liquid Crystal & OLED Material Precursor: Serves as a building block for synthesizing novel organic electronic materials and liquid crystal compounds.
  • Cross-Coupling Reactions: An effective substrate in palladium-catalyzed cross-coupling reactions (e.g., Suzuki, Heck, Sonogashira) for creating biaryl structures.
  • Ligand and Catalyst Development: Utilized in the preparation of specialized ligands and organocatalysts for asymmetric synthesis.
  • Polymer Modification: Acts as a functional monomer or modifier in the synthesis of specialty polymers with tailored properties.

Basic Information

Product Name 4-(1-Bromoethyl)Benzonitrile
CAS No. 101860-82-6
Molecular Formula C9H8BrN
Molecular Weight 210.07 g/mol
Synonyms 1-(4-Cyanophenyl)ethyl bromide; p-(1-Bromoethyl)benzonitrile; 4-(1-Bromoethyl)benzonitrile; α-Bromo-4-cyanophenylethane; (4-Cyanophenyl)ethyl bromide; 4-Cyanophenethyl bromide; 1-Bromo-1-(4-cyanophenyl)ethane

Storage

Preserve in a tightly closed container, protected from light. Store in a cool, dry, and well-ventilated place at room temperature (15-25°C). Due to its hygroscopic nature, the container must be kept tightly sealed to exclude moisture. Keep away from incompatible materials such as strong bases and reducing agents.
